Professional values and professional quality of life among mental health nurses: A cross‐sectional study

Abstract

A statistically positive relationship was found between nurses' professional values and compassion satisfaction.

  • Nurses' professional values may significantly predict their professional quality of life.
  • 44% of the variance in compassion satisfaction and 24% in burnout can be explained by professional values, education level, consideration of changing units, and social life allocation.
  • Considering changes in job units is the most important predictor of compassion satisfaction.
  • Truth value is identified as the most significant predictor of burnout.
  • Nurses who adhere to professional values could experience higher levels of compassion satisfaction and burnout.
  • Higher compassion satisfaction is associated with lower levels of compassion fatigue.
